jIBS is a clone of the well-known Backgammon server FIBS. It allows Internet users to play backgammon in real-time against real people (and even some bots).
Most players use a graphical interface to allow the easy 'point and click' approach

A tool for DungeonMasters of a D20 role playing game (like Dungeons & Dragons). It helps organizing the combat, remembering the actions a character performed and keeping track of the duration of effects.

jose is a graphical Chess tool.

You can store chess games in a database.
You can view and edit games (including variations and comments).
You can play against a plugged-in chess engine and use it for analysis.
Features 3D board view.
Project CodeRacers is a game geared for creative java programmers. It's main idea is that each player will create an own AI agent (the so-called "driver"). The user's driver then will compete against other players' drivers in a simulated car race.

Our current project is called "Bolzplatz 2006" (English title "Slam Soccer 2006", French title "Coup de Fout 2006"). It's a freeware 3D-soccer-game in comic-style and a funny allusion to the World Cup 2006 in Germany.
